FILE - In this Dec. 19, 2020, file photo, Utah running back Ty Jordan (22) runs for a score as he eludes a tackle by Washington State linebacker Jahad Woods (13) during the second half of an NCAA college football game in Salt Lake City. This was supposed to be Jordan’s time. Instead, Utah approaches a new football season facing the unexpected and unwanted challenge of replacing Jordan in the backfield. Jordan died at 19 after an accidental shooting on Dec. 26.  (AP Photo/Rick Bowmer, File)

FILE - In this Dec. 19, 2020, file photo, Washington State head coach Nick Rolovich looks on during the first half of an NCAA college football game against Utah in Salt Lake City. Kassidy Woods, former football player for Washington State University contends in a lawsuit, filed Aug. 20, 2021, in federal court for the northern district of Texas in Dallas, that his civil rights were violated when he was kicked off the football team after complaining about potential exposure to COVID-19 and for joining an association of Black student-athletes.
